Referring to a 4-wheel drive Formula Student Electric vehicle, a fractional-slot synchronous permanent magnet machine has been designed. Torque density has been improved adopting outer rotor topology and lightweight materials. An ironless rotor with PMs placed in an Halbach array configuration allows reduced rotor inertia to be obtained. The results described in the paper provide a quantitative assessment...
This article gives a comparative analysis of different traction motor types. This analysis allows one to choose an electric motor for a serial-hybrid vehicle. The authors of the article have been made the analysis of publications on this subject. In the article the authors consider four electric motor types: DC machines, AC machines, permanent magnet machines and the switched reluctance motor. The...
Dynamic behavior analysis of electric motors are required in order to accurately evaluate the performance, energy consumption and pollution level of hybrid electric vehicles. Due to high torque to inertia ratio, high reliability, high efficiency and power density, five phase interior permanent magnet machines (IPMs) are good candidate for hybrid electric vehicles.
